What is BONUSVIEW?

BONUSVIEW allows you to enjoy functions such as picture-in-picture or secondary audio etc., with BD-Video supporting BD-ROM Profile 1 version 1.1/ Final Standard Profile.

What is BD-Live?

In addition to the BONUSVIEW function, BD-Video supporting BD-ROM Profile 2 that has a network extension function allows you to enjoy more functions such as subtitles, exclusive images and online games by connecting this unit to the Internet. In order to use the Internet feature, you must have this unit connected to a broadband network (> 11).

≥These discs may not be on sale in certain regions.

≥The usable functions and the operating method may vary with each disc, please refer to the instructions on the disc and/or visit their website.

Playback

Secondary video can be played from a disc compatible with the picture-in-picture function.

For the playback method, refer to the instructions for the disc.

To turn on/off secondary video

Secondary video

Press [PIP].

Secondary video is played.

≥Press the button to turn it ON and OFF.

To turn on/off secondary audio

Set “Soundtrack” in “Secondary Video” to “On” or “Off”. (> 33, “Signal Type”)

1)Insert an SD card (> 16).

2)Press [START].

3)Press [3, 4] to select “To Others” and press [OK].

4)Press [3, 4] to select “Card Management” and press [OK].

5)Press [3, 4] to select “BD-Video Data Erase” or “Format SD Card” and press [OK].

6)Press [2, 1] to select “Yes” and press [OK].

7)Press [2, 1] to select “Start” and press [OK].
